Cardiff City was founded in 1899 and is the only non-English side to win one of the three major English competitions. The 1920s were glorious years for ‘The Bluebirds’ not only winning the FA Cup in 1927 but also finishing runners up in the English League in 1923/24. There FA Cup victory was the first final to be broadcast by the BBC on radio. Cardiff City was formally known as Riverside A.F.C. and founded to keep the cricket players from the Riverside Cricket Club fit during the winter months.
